Das dürfte wenig mit Gluon und den Knoten zu tun haben und viel mit alfred. Habt ihr mehrere master?

Wir haben nur einen Alfred Master und von dem kommen die Daten für beide Karten.

Mit ist aber eben aufgefallen dass der ntp auf dem Elementa Knoten nicht funktioniert hat. Könnte das zu Problemen führen? Wobei der Knoten auch gut 20 Minuten nach dem Reboot wieder auf beiden Karten auftaucht.

Das ntp nicht funktioniert könnte die gleiche Ursache haben. Dabei könnte es sich um Paketverlust handeln oder auch einen Bug in batman-adv oder dem Bridgecode.
